Nouveau Liste des pistes vidéo(des pistesopter)
Créez une instance de cette classe.
Paramètres :
| Prénom | Type | Attributs | Défaut | Description |
|---|---|---|---|---|
pistes |
matrice.<VideoTrack> |
<facultatif> |
[] |
Une liste de |
- Voir :
S'étend
Membres
-
longueur : numéro
-
Le nombre actuel de
pistesdans ce Trackist.- Remplace :
-
Indice sélectionné : numéro
-
L'index actuel de la VideoTrack sélectionnée ».
Méthodes
-
Ajouter un écouteur d'événements()
-
Un alias de EventTarget #on. Permet à
EventTargetd'imiter l'API DOM standard.- Remplace :
- Voir :
-
AddTrack(piste)
-
Ajoutez un VideoTrack à la
VideoTrackList.Paramètres :
Prénom Type Description pistePiste vidéo Le VideoTrack à ajouter à la liste
Incendies :
- Remplace :
-
DispatchEvent()
-
Un alias de EventTarget #trigger. Permet à
EventTargetd'imiter l'API DOM standard.- Remplace :
- Voir :
-
désactivé(type, fn)
-
Supprime un écouteur d'
événementspour un événement spécifique d'une instance d'EventTarget. Cela permet à l'écouteurd'événement dene plus être appelé lorsque l'événement nommé se produit.Paramètres :
Prénom Type Description typestring | Array.<corde> Un nom d'événement ou un tableau de noms d'événements.
fnEventTarget~EventListener La fonction à supprimer.
- Remplace :
-
On(type, fn)
-
Ajoute un écouteur d'
événementsà une instance d'unEventTarget. Un écouteur d'événementsest une fonction qui sera appelée lorsqu'un événement portant un certain nom est déclenché.Paramètres :
Prénom Type Description typestring | Array.<corde> Un nom d'événement ou un tableau de noms d'événements.
fnEventTarget~EventListener La fonction à appeler avec
EventTargets- Remplace :
-
un(type, fn)
-
Cette fonction ajoutera un écouteur d'
événementsqui n'est déclenché qu'une seule fois. Après le premier déclencheur, il sera retiré. C'est comme ajouter unécouteur d'événementavec Cible de l'événement#on qui appelle EventTarget#off sur lui-même.Paramètres :
Prénom Type Description typestring | Array.<corde> Un nom d'événement ou un tableau de noms d'événements.
fnEventTarget~EventListener Fonction à appeler une fois pour chaque nom d'événement.
- Remplace :
-
Supprimer EventListener()
-
Un alias de EventTarget #off. Permet à
EventTargetd'imiter l'API DOM standard.- Remplace :
- Voir :
-
RemoveTrack(piste)
-
Supprimer une piste de la
TrackListParamètres :
Prénom Type Description pistePiste Piste audio, vidéo ou texte à supprimer de la liste.
Incendies :
- Remplace :
-
trigger(événement)
-
Cette fonction provoque l'apparition d'un événement. Cela entraînera alors
l'appel de tous les écouteursd'événements qui attendent cet événement. S'il n'y a pasd'écouteurs d'événementspour un événement, rien ne se produira.Si le nom de l'
événementdéclenché est dansEventTarget.AllowedEvents_. Le déclencheur appellera également leau+majusculeEventNamefonction.Exemple : "click" figure dans
EventTarget.allowedEvents_, le déclencheur tentera donc d'appeleronClicks'il existe.Paramètres :
Prénom Type Description événementstring | EventTarget~Event | Objet Nom de l'événement, d'un
événementou d'un objet dont la clé de type est définie sur un nom d'événement.- Remplace :
Evénements
-
addtrack
-
Déclenché lorsqu'une piste est ajoutée à une liste de pistes.
Type:
Propriétés :
Prénom Type Description pistePiste Une référence à la piste qui a été ajoutée.
- Remplace :
-
changement
-
Déclenché lorsqu'une piste différente est sélectionnée/activée.
Type:
- Remplace :
-
enlever la piste
-
Déclenché lorsqu'une piste est supprimée de la liste des pistes.
Type:
Propriétés :
Prénom Type Description pistePiste Référence à la piste qui a été supprimée.
- Remplace :